What is Freeze Dried Food and How Does it Work?
Freeze dried food is a preservation method that removes the water content from fresh foods, including meats like chicken, through a process called sublimation. In this process, frozen food is placed in a vacuum-sealed chamber and subjected to low pressure while slowly increasing the temperature. This causes the ice crystals to turn into vapor without going through the liquid phase, resulting in dehydrated but nutrient-rich food that can be stored for extended periods without refrigeration.
The advantages of freeze-drying over other methods include retaining more of the original texture, flavor, color and nutritional value of the food; having a longer shelf life; being lightweight and portable for outdoor activities like camping or backpacking where weight and space are at a premium; and being easy to rehydrate by adding hot water or other liquids before cooking. Chicken freeze dried meals offer all these benefits plus provide an excellent source of protein prized by athletes, hikers, hunters or anyone looking for quick yet satisfying meal options on-the-go.

How to Store Chicken Freeze Dried Meals for Long-Term Use
Storing chicken freeze dried meals properly is crucial for their long-term use. The good news is that they are easy to store and have a long shelf life. The key to proper storage is keeping them in a cool, dry place away from direct sunlight. This will prevent moisture from getting in and spoiling the food. It's also important to keep them in an airtight container or bag to prevent exposure to air, which can cause oxidation and spoilage.
If stored correctly, chicken freeze dried meals can last up to 25 years! This makes them an excellent option for emergency preparedness kits or for those who want to stock up on food for future adventures. It's important to check the expiration date on the packaging before consuming, as expired food can be dangerous.
